BLOCKCHAIN-BASED APPROACH TO ENHANCE DATA PRIVACY IN E-GOVERNANCE SYSTEMS
Abstract
The increasing digitization of government services has raised critical concerns about data privacy, security, and trust in e-governance systems. This study proposes a blockchain-based approach to enhance data privacy, transparency, and accountability in e-governance platforms. The model leverages decentralized ledger technology to ensure secure data storage, immutability of records, and verifiable user access without reliance on a central authority. Smart contracts are integrated to automate service delivery while maintaining confidentiality through cryptographic protocols. The proposed system was designed and evaluated using simulated e-governance datasets, demonstrating improved data integrity, resistance to tampering, and privacy preservation compared to traditional centralized architectures. The study concludes that blockchain technology offers a viable framework for establishing citizen trust and regulatory compliance in digital governance environments.
Keywords: Blockchain, data privacy, e-governance, smart contracts, decentralization, cybersecurity.
